"Garden State Manufacturing Jobs Act."
This bill proposes creating a new corporate status called "Garden State Corporation" for manufacturing businesses operating primarily in New Jersey. It requires these corporations to include half of their board members elected by employees working in New Jersey facilities, giving workers equal voting rights and access to company records. The bill also offers significant tax credits: up to 60% of certain taxes for the first five years if the company qualifies as both a Garden State Corporation and a benefit corporation, decreasing over time. This would directly affect eligible New Jersey manufacturing companies that choose to adopt this corporate structure, with the tax benefits applying over nine years. The bill is currently pending before the Assembly Commerce Committee.
